The M74HCT640RM13TR is an 8-bit transceiver and inverting logic IC chip, part of the 74HCT series, manufactured by STMicroelectronics. This device is designed for surface mount applications and is packaged in a 20-lead small outline package (SOP) with tape and reel (TR) packaging. It operates within a supply voltage range of 4.5V to 5.5V and is capable of delivering an output current of 6mA for both high and low states. The M74HCT640RM13TR is classified under ECCN EAR99 and HTSUS 8542.39.0001, indicating its compliance with international export regulations. The device also meets REACH and RoHS3 standards, ensuring environmental and safety compliance. M74HCT640RM13TR Features
8-bit Transceiver and Inverting Logic: The M74HCT640RM13TR is designed to handle 8-bit data transmission with inverting logic, making it suitable for applications requiring data inversion and bidirectional data transfer.
Wide Operating Voltage Range: The device operates within a supply voltage range of 4.5V to 5.5V, providing flexibility and compatibility with various power supply configurations.
High Output Current Capability: With an output current capability of 6mA for both high and low states, the M74HCT640RM13TR can drive multiple loads efficiently.
Surface Mount Technology (SMT): The surface mount package type ensures ease of integration into modern PCB designs, reducing the overall footprint and enhancing thermal performance.
Environmental Compliance: The M74HCT640RM13TR is REACH unaffected and ROHS3 compliant, ensuring it meets the stringent environmental and safety standards required in the electronics industry.
Moisture Sensitivity Level (MSL) 1: The device is classified under MSL 1, indicating it is not moisture-sensitive and can be stored and handled without special precautions.
